Ampjack has successfully completed hundreds ofprojects to date with a one hundred percent safety record. Its' first-ever project was in the New York state area. The client had a ten-mile line that they needed to de-energize if not repaired by a specific date. Ampjack analyzed the ground clearances and determined that by raising 14 structures, they could get the line back to the safe operating condition. The company engineered and fabricated the extension steel and installed all 14 extensions within a few months. This way, Ampjack saved the client from ISO and NERC penalties. Also, with the complete upgrade, the line achieved its' original design capacity. As a result, the client could continue to supply electricity properly to their customers and make additional revenue while maintaining reliability of their system.
